If you want to play games forget about vista. No EAX in vista. Few games have compatibility problems. My nvidia driver keeps crashing. You can play css and hl2 though. doom3 supports 5.1 using openAL but there is huge framerate drop. Even some games like stalker and gothic 3 has problems in vista. I didn't have problems with applications but i used very few applications on it.
